Health, human services and disability providers urge council to protect HHS programs, minority health initiatives and DD supplement
Summary
Representatives of public‑health coalitions, community clinics and developmental‑disability providers asked the County Council to preserve funding for Department of Health and Human Services programs, minority health initiatives, community clinics and the developmental‑disability (DD) supplement for direct support professionals.
MONTGOMERY COUNTY, Md. — Health and human‑services advocates and disability‑service providers told the County Council at the April 8 hearing that funding for HHS programs, minority health initiatives, community clinics and the developmental‑disability supplement should be preserved amid state and federal uncertainty.
